    Corporal Christian Brown a former squad leader with 1st Battalion, 6th Marine Regiment, looks onto his supporters during the Cost of Freedom Poker Run in New Bern, N.C. Aug. 24, 2013. “This event is (for) Christian Brown, to help him achieve his goals, his life aspirations, his new home and to get it the way he wants it and the way he needs it,” said Sgt. Maj. Larry J. Harrington, the Motor Transport Squadron 1 sergeant major aboard Marine Corps Air Station Cherry Point. The poker run consisted of motorcycle riders traveling to five checkpoints. At each location the riders received a playing card, and whoever had the highest poker hand at the end of the route won. Brown, who lost both of his legs while serving as a squad leader with 1st Battalion, 6th Marine Regiment during Operation Enduring Freedom, was awarded the Silver Star Medal May 3, 2013.
